Block 1,039,657
Block Hash
d57946891b971b07d2eced2d444d8f99a25820e763a07cc8d83d0ea40c
a6e818
Previous Block Hash
c568c7fc31040cd04c7f9686e971bb87f004520af9617b6bf0a034c87b 601480
Mined
Transactions
2
Difficulty
30.51 M
Size
397 bytes
Transactions (2)
1 input, 1 output
10,000.00226
PEPE
1 input, 2 outputs
127,145.66449605
PEPE